Meaning of Pareechehra
Pareechehra is a compound Persian name with clear etymological roots. The first component ‘Paree’ (پری) comes from Persian mythology, referring to fairies or nymphs—supernatural beings known for their exquisite beauty and magical qualities. The second component ‘Chehra’ (چہرہ) means face or countenance in both Persian and Urdu. Together, they create the literal meaning ‘fairy-faced,’ suggesting someone with extraordinary, almost otherworldly beauty. This name appears in classical Persian poetry where ‘Paree’ is a common metaphor for beauty, and ‘Chehra’ emphasizes facial features. The combination reflects the Persian poetic tradition of using supernatural imagery to describe human beauty.

Origin & Cultural Significance
Pareechehra originates from Persian culture, specifically from the rich tradition of Persian poetry and naming conventions. While commonly used in Muslim communities across Iran, Afghanistan, Pakistan, and India, the name itself is not exclusively Islamic but rather cultural. It gained popularity through classical Persian literature where descriptions of beauty often invoked fairy imagery. The name represents the Persian aesthetic ideal that values subtle, ethereal beauty over mere physical attractiveness. Today, it remains popular in Persian-influenced regions and among diaspora communities who appreciate its cultural heritage and poetic resonance.
